STRCASECMP

Section: C Library Functions (3)
索引 jman

BSD mandoc
 

索引

名称

strcasecmp strncasecmp - 大文字小文字を無視した文字列の比較  

索引

ライブラリ

Lb libc  

索引

書式

In string.h Ft int Fn strcasecmp const char *s1 const char *s2 Ft int Fn strncasecmp const char *s1 const char *s2 size_t len  

索引

解説

Fn strcasecmp および Fn strncasecmp 関数は、ヌル文字で終了する文字列 Fa s1 および Fa s2 を比較します。

Fn strncasecmp は、最大で Fa len 個の文字を比較します。  

索引

戻り値

Fn strcasecmp および Fn strncasecmp は、それぞれの文字を小文字に変換した後に Fa s1 が Fa s2 よりも辞書式順序で大きいか、等しいか、あるいは小さいかに応じて、 それぞれ、0 より大きい、0 に等しい、 あるいは 0 より小さい整数を返します。 文字列自体は修正されません。比較は、 `\200 ' が `\0' よりも大きくなるように、unsigned char を使って行います。  

索引

関連項目

bcmp(3), memcmp(3), strcmp(3), strcoll(3), strxfrm(3), tolower(3)  

索引

歴史

Fn strcasecmp および Fn strncasecmp 関数は、 BSD 4.4 ではじめて登場しました。


 

索引

Index

名称
ライブラリ
書式
解説
戻り値
関連項目
歴史

jman



Time: 07:07:10 GMT, January 12, 2009